The Europa League this week is highlighted by the match between Borussia Dortmund and Liverpool. In this article, we find out where to watch all the games live on TV and online via official streaming sources.

Liverpool coach Jürgen Klopp will return to his old side when he leads the Reds against his former club Borussia Dortmund on Thursday. The English side, who defeated rivals Manchester United in the previous stage of the Europa League, have not lost a single match in the competition this season. On the other hand, Dortmund are currently enjoying a 20-match unbeaten run, with their star striker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ang having scored five goals in his last five matches.

Sparta Praha also face Villarreal away from home, hoping to become the first Czech side to reach the semifinals of the UEFA Europa League since Slavia Praha made it to the Last 4 of the tournament’s old form, the UEFA Cup, in the 1995/96 season.

 

It’s an all-Spanish affair when Athletic Club come up against Sevilla at the San Mames stadium. Interestingly, none of the two clubs were able to grab victories over the weekend in La Liga.

Sporting Braga host Shakhtar Donetsk, in what could be a fierce battle. The Portuguese are so far the most fouled side of the Europa League with 151 infringements against them.

Where to watch the Europa League live on TV?

Live TV coverage of the Europa League this week in USA is on Fox Sports 1, Fox Sports 2 and Fox Soccer Plus. Two matches will be available live on UK TV on BT Sport 2, BT Sport Europe and BT Sport Showcase. BeIN Sports will also air a match in Canada, whereas TSN2 and RDS2 will provide English and French coverage of the Liverpool game respectively.

Where to stream the Europa League live online?

All Europa League matches will be streamed live on Fox Soccer 2Go. The games telecast live on Fox Sports will also be available on the Fox Sports Go app and online, whereas ESPN3 will further extend live streaming access with coverage of two games. These matches on ESPN3 will also be accessible online and on mobile via WatchESPN.

In the UK, all four matches will be up for streaming on the BT Sport app and online. BeIN Sports Connect will have one exclusive matchup, whereas TSN Go and RDS Go will simulcast the TV game picked by both networks.
